Mobile Hardware Advances

Xiaomi's 17T Pro emerged as the top trending phone this week, earning the title of "camera and battery powerhouse" after hands-on testing confirmed its flagship capabilities at a sub-$1,500 price point. The device joins its 17T sibling in Amazon UK's launch lineup, where both models received immediate price cuts alongside discounts on Samsung's S26 Ultra and iPhone Air. Samsung's Galaxy Z Fold8 underwent major design changes in latest leaks, featuring a wider screen while the Ultra variant retains a narrower form factor, according to the same tipster who shared photos of what appears to be the iPhone Fold in white/silver configuration. Meanwhile, vivo's X500 Ultra may arrive with a 10x telephoto camera, the X Fold6 is reportedly launching this month, and the Y500 global series expands to three versions, all part of a broader push that includes Xiaomi's Bold Yellow Poco X8 Pro refresh and Realme's P4R 5G teaser campaign.

Wearables and Computing

Asus unveiled its VivoWatch 6 Plus at Computex alongside new 12.2-inch Pad tablet marking its return to the tablet market. The smartwatch features ECG and blood pressure monitoring on a 1.43-inch AMOLED display, though pricing details remain sparse. ASUS also re-entered the gaming handheld space with the ROG Xbox Ally X20, featuring a 7.4-inch OLED screen and new TMR joysticks, while revealing the Expert Book B5 Flip G2, a 2.9-pound 360-degree touchscreen laptop among other Windows convertible models. Samsung's Galaxy Fit3 successor is expected by mid-2026, and Google's Pixel Watch 5 appeared in Indian certification listings with four model numbers confirmed, following alleged ocean-surfaced leaks of the device.

AI Infrastructure and Software Updates

Alphabet committed $80 billion to AI infrastructure scaling through stock sales, positioning Google to compete with rivals in the generative AI race. This investment coincides with Android 17 Beta 4.1 rollout ahead of the mid-2026 debut, while the company enabled website opt-outs from AI search results without affecting regular search placement. Google's June Android Drop introduced smart shopping features including AI-powered digital wardrobes and outfit search, alongside child safety protections and caller impersonation warnings. The Fitbit app overhaul under Google Health has drawn criticism from longtime users, though customization options remain available. Samsung's One UI 9 update changes power-off procedures for security, while the Galaxy A34, A25, A16 4G, M35, and A06 receive the One UI 8.5 stable update.

Policy, Regulation, and Market Moves

Poland moved to ban phones and smartwatches in schools as part of broader legislation targeting classroom technology. Meanwhile, Instagram implemented new restrictions on teen post visibility for content related to body image and mental health, and Meta offered employees 30-minute breaks from tracking for personal check-ins. Florida sued OpenAI and Sam Altman over alleged user exploitation following a mass shooter incident at FSU reportedly involving Chat GPT planning. Amazon's Prime Day 2026 runs June 23-26, earlier than the previous year, offering Prime members early access to Spider-Man: Brand New Day tickets. Disney appears to be integrating Hulu into Disney+ rather than maintaining standalone service viability.

Hardware and Consumer Electronics

Oppo's mid-range A-series rumored to feature a 10,000 mAh battery alongside other unspecified specifications, while its Color OS 17 may borrow Apple's Liquid Glass UI elements ahead of its Android 17-based release. One Plus unveiled Turbo 6X and Turbo 6X Pro specs adding to its expanding Turbo lineup. Motorola's Edge 2026 and Moto Buds 2 prioritize comfort, battery life, and practicality over AI features, while the Razr 2026 reached "best budget flip phone" status at T-Mobile where it's available for free with eligible plan additions. Huawei's nova 16 series launched with 7,000 mAh batteries and 50MP RYYB periscope cameras, with the nova 16 Ultra featuring a 200MP main camera. Samsung's portable T9 SSD scored a rare discount at Amazon, offering 1TB for $0.25 per gigabyte.
